On 23 Jul 99, at 9:30, Steven Ayres wrote: > Z-bar assembly = upper swing arm assembly = anti-sway bar assembly? > If we're talking about the same thing, no; the upper arms rotate > together on the ends of the same bar without limitation, so they work > the same in any position. Doesn't the Z-bar end arm point to the rear on one side and to the front on the other, hence the name? If so, this comes into play more as the car settles lower. If both arms face the same direction then it is a sway bar and what you say is correct.
